About 4-(1,4-diazepan-1-yl)quinoline

4-(1,4-diazepan-1-yl)quinoline (PubChem CID 61339543) has the molecular formula C14H17N3 and a molecular weight of 227.31 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is 4-(1,4-diazepan-1-yl)quinoline.

What are the key properties of 4-(1,4-diazepan-1-yl)quinoline?
4-(1,4-diazepan-1-yl)quinoline has a molecular weight of 227.31 g/mol, XLogP of 2.03, 1 rotatable bonds, 1 hydrogen bond donors, and 3 hydrogen bond acceptors.
